

Wayne Stratton Brooks, age 75, passed away on Saturday, February 4, 2012 surrounded by his loving family. Wayne was born December 18, 1936 in Englewood, CO to parents Howard S. and Elsie Brooks. He lived in Colorado and Idaho until the family moved to Salida, CA in 1950. He attended Modesto High School, graduating Class of 1955. Wayne was very proud to serve in the Marine Corp, and it was then, during his 3 years of service, that he married his wife Jackie on September 21, 1957. They settled in Modesto, CA, where he later retired from PG&E after 35 years of service. Wayne stayed active playing city league softball, bowling, hunting, and fishing. With his strong passion for music, he played lead guitar in his band, The Dalton Gang for many years. Later in life, he discovered golf, which he and Jackie enjoyed together. He was also a proud member of the Silver Panthers. Wayne will be deeply missed by his family, and all those who were lucky to have known him. Wayne is survived by his loving wife of 54 years, Jacqueline Brooks; his four daughters, Julie Shaver (Rick), Erin Primofiore (Dino), Teri McGhee (Mario), and Debra Schell (Tom); his sister Carolyn Luth (John) and brother-in-law Chuck Henry. He also had 9 grandchildren, 4 great-grandchildren, and 1 more on the way. In lieu of flowers, donations can be made to American Diabetes Association.
